sqlserver数据库修改字符集失败先将数据库改为单用户模式,修改字符集之后再改回来就可以了 。
怀疑是pymssql.connect指定的字符集跟数据库使用的字符集不符 , 尝试修改charset 。
这条错误信息是报告:SQL数据库当前的用户连接数太多 。正如X/Open和SQL访问组SQLCAE规范(1992)所定义的那样,SQLSTATE值是一个由5个字符组成的字符串,其中包含数值或大写字母,代表各种错误或警告条件的代码 。
修改了字符集,但插入中文时仍然有问题,这或许就如上面资料所说的通过修改SYS.PROPS$来修改主要是对应客户端的显示,与存储无关,所以仍旧是乱码 。然后我重新创建了个数据库,指定字符集为AL32UTF8,插入中文就没问题了 。
数据库字符集在创建后原则上不能更改 。如果需要修改字符集,通常需要导出数据库数据,重建数据库,再导入数据库数据的方式来转换 。
Java连接sqlserver数据库的字符集问题?1、FileInputStream fs=null;问题出在这,这是字节流,是一个字节一个字节传输的,汉语是每个字都是一个字符(也就是两个字节),一个字节一个字节读当然乱码了 。试试FileReader这个类 。
2、jdbc:microsoft:sqlserver://localhost:1433; DatabaseName=Test,sa,);你的配置有问题了,检查一下这句话 。提示没有找到数据源 。很可能是你数据库的验证方式是用winnt方式验证 。或者你的密码不正确 。
3、要向连接数据库,首先应该保证数据库服务打开 数据库服务打开之后就可以在环境中编写连接代码了 。如图:连接数据库就是这两个步骤:1)加载驱动、2)创建连接 。注意在导包是导入的java.sql下的 。
【sqlserver更改字符集,sqlserver 修改字段类型语句】关于sqlserver更改字符集和sqlserver 修改字段类型语句的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站 。
推荐阅读
- mysql表怎么设置负数 mysql如何设置表的字符集
- 移动pop服务器,pop服务器端怎么填
- pc飞行空战游戏,pc 空战游戏
- java移动圆的代码 java集合移动元素
- oracle查询ll拼接,oracle查询结果字段拼接字符串
- 动车模拟游戏,动车模拟驾驶游戏
- linux打印所有命令,linux 打印
- 怎么关闭oracle进程 如何关闭oracle
- 包含查询mysql程序文件的命令的词条